Michigan Offers Brother Rice Kicker Cameron Wilson
Cameron Wilson, a Class of 2025 kicker from Brother Rice High School, has received a scholarship offer from the University of Michigan. Wilson, a 6-foot-2, 180-pound specialist, has a strong leg, booting 45-yard field goals in practice with ease. He has also shown accuracy, making 10 of 12 attempts from 30-40 yards. In addition to Michigan, Wilson has already received offers from Purdue and Illinois. As a member of the 8A Brother Rice Crusaders, Wilson looks to build on his impressive summer camp performances, which have caught the attention of college scouts. Wilson plans to attend Michigan's summer camp and visit the campus in August. He will begin narrowing down his recruitment in the fall, with a commitment decision expected in early 2024.
